Compare the zeros of Function R and the zeros of Function S.

In assessing the performance of two functions, an analyst graphed Function R, which is quadratic, and Function S, which is linear. The graph shows Function R as a parabola opening downward with its vertex at the point (3,4), crossing the x-axis at x=1 and x=5. Function S is represented by a set of points and appears linear, crossing the x-axis at x=-2 and x=3.

Which statement about the zeros of the functions is true?

a) Function S has the greater zero, which is 3.

b) Function R has the greater zero, which is 5.

c) Function S has the smaller zero, which is -2.

d) Function R has the smaller zero, which is 1.
